Punish anyone trying to help Australians linked to IS return home, says Opposition
Thirty-four women and children have been issued Australian passports and are trying to return from Syria (pictured, Al-Roj camp in Northern Syria). Photo: Save the Children Australia. The Federal Government has dismissed as headline-grabbing an Opposition proposal to make it a crime to assist any Australians with links to Islamic State to return from Syria. Currently, 34 wives and children of former fighters are trying to get back to Australia, …
